Max Pyro Event Sets Texas Sky Ablaze

Max Pyro Event Sets Texas Sky Ablaze
Friday, May 1, 2020

A brave team gathered at Skydive Spaceland-Houston in Rosharon, Texas, March 12-16 to do something extraordinary: attempt a 42-way Fédération Aéronautique Internationale World Record for Largest Head-Down Formation Skydive at Night. Adding to the visual display, each jumper wore pyrotechnics.
